javacsript 处理excel表格式遇到日期格式xxxx/xx/xx的数据怎么判断是日期格式
时间: 2023-12-23 14:05:29 浏览: 34
如果你要判断一个字符串是否为日期格式,例如 "xxxx/xx/xx",可以使用正则表达式来检查它是否符合日期格式的规则。
以下是一个简单的正则表达式,可以用来匹配类似于 "xxxx/xx/xx" 这样的日期格式:
```
const dateRegex = /^\d{4}\/\d{2}\/\d{2}$/;
if (dateRegex.test("2021/08/17")) {
console.log("匹配成功");
} else {
console.log("匹配失败");
}
```
上面的代码中,我们首先定义了一个正则表达式 `dateRegex`,它使用了 `^\d{4}\/\d{2}\/\d{2}$` 这个模式来匹配日期格式的字符串。
其中,`\d{4}` 匹配 4 个数字,表示年份;`\/` 表示斜杠;`\d{2}` 匹配 2 个数字,表示月份和日期。
然后,我们使用 `test()` 方法来检查一个字符串是否符合日期格式的规则。如果匹配成功,就说明这个字符串是一个日期格式的字符串。
注意,这个正则表达式只能用来匹配类似于 "xxxx/xx/xx" 这样的日期格式,如果你要处理其他格式的日期字符串,可能需要使用更加复杂的正则表达式来进行匹配。
相关问题
<el-date-picker />日期格式xxxx-xx-xx
<el-date-picker /> 是一个常用的日期选择器组件,它支持多种日期格式。其中,日期格式“xxxx-xx-xx”表示年份-月份-日期,例如2021年7月23日的日期格式就是“2021-07-23”。这个日期格式在很多场景下都很常见,比如在数据库存储日期、前端页面展示日期等。如果你需要使用该日期格式,可以在<el-date-picker />组件中设置格式为“yyyy-MM-dd”,其中“yyyy”表示四位数的年份,“MM”表示两位数的月份,“dd”表示两位数的日期。
delphi10 maskedit限制日期显示为xxxx/xx/xx
您可以使用 Delphi 中的 `TMaskEdit` 控件和 `Mask` 属性来限制日期的显示格式为 `xxxx/xx/xx`。具体步骤如下:
1. 在 Delphi 中创建一个新的窗体或表单。
2. 将 `TMaskEdit` 控件拖放到窗体或表单中。
3. 在 `Properties` 窗口中找到 `Mask` 属性,将其设置为 `9999/99/99`。
4. 运行程序,您会看到 `TMaskEdit` 控件只能输入符合格式 `xxxx/xx/xx` 的日期。
希望这可以帮助到您!如果您有任何其他问题,请随时问我。